Qualcomm PMIC Staff FuSa Engineer 
India, Karnataka, Bengaluru 
824880802

23.06.2024

Job Area:

Engineering Group, Engineering Group > Hardware Engineering

Responsibilities Include:

  • The PMIC functional safety engineer is responsible for developing the safety concept and strategies/measures to mitigate risks for identified potential faults.

  • This includes working on the high-level safety goal for PMIC and translating it into a Technical Safety Concept.

  • Review system safety architecture and its interfaces to investigate faults.

  • Lead the FTA, DFA and FMEDA analysis for the PMIC.

  • Work with design/system engineers to develop and document module level functional safety requirements.

  • Lead the DFMEA analysis of failure modes at the IP & integration level.

  • Generate safety requirements at various levels of hierarchy and review verification plans.

  • Engage with suppliers (3rd party IP) and review safety work products to conduct detailed functional safety analysis.

  • Work with cross-functional teams within Qualcomm to achieve the desired safety integrity levels.

  • Review, approve and provide guidance for design and firmware verification plans.

  • Guide development/verification teams to reach the safety objectives at various project milestones.

  • Lead Anomaly reports on safety critical engineering change requests.

Requirements:

  • B.E. or higher degree in Electronics or Systems Engineering.

  • Strong background in PMIC hardware and software functions and their validation is desirable.

  • Experience with Systems architecture and control systems is preferred.

  • Collaborative team player with strong communication skills. Ability to explain safety concepts to other engineers.

  • Knowledge and experience with ISO 26262/IEC61508 are preferred.

  • Experience using requirements management tools such as Jama.

  • Training skills to ramp up engineers with the ISO26262 processes.

  • Self-starter and work with limited supervision.

Minimum Qualifications:

•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Electrical/Electronics Engineering, Engineering, or related field and 4+ years of Hardware Engineering or related work experience.

Master's degree in Computer Science, Electrical/Electronics Engineering, Engineering, or related field and 3+ years of Hardware Engineering or related work experience.

PhD in Computer Science, Electrical/Electronics Engineering, Engineering, or related field and 2+ years of Hardware Engineering or related work experience.
